NJ Lottery scrapped instant scratch-off game after only 3 days
High Card Poker rules were confusing By Todd Northrop The New Jersey Lottery pulled its latest instant scratch-off game from retailers' shelves after players became confused by the game's rules. High Card Poker (Game #01436) went on sale Aug. 7, and was canceled three days later on Aug. 10. In a statement, the NJ Lottery said the cancellation was due to the potential for players to misunderstand the game's win scenarios as stated on the back of tickets. Despite the game being voide

West Lafayette man wins $1 million on last 'Hoosier Millionaire'
A West Lafayette, Indiana, man won $1,022,000 on the final Hoosier Millionaire television show, which ended its 16-year run Saturday night with a special broadcast.Clarence Moore's winnings on the Grand Finale show boosted his total prize money, including winnings from preliminary rounds, to $1,044,000. He became the show's 191st and last millionaire.After drawing from 36,000 entries, 12 semifinalists were selected to compete in two preliminary rounds, where the top six players competed in t

Some players unhappy with UK Lotto game changes
Loss of Millionaire Raffle rankles Scots The United Kingdom National Lottery is facing a boycott from outraged Scottish players who branded the Lotto game's prize draw an absolute con after lottery operator Camelot changed its rules. Lotto bosses have come under fire for scrapping the Lotto Millionaire Raffle which awarded a 1 million payout twice a week. Since the canceled game add-on was a raffle and not a lotto draw, there was a guaranteed 1 million prize winner every drawing, rather
